A yellow light is technically a "clear the intersection" light -- you're SUPPOSED TO move into the intersection when you're making a left hand turn. If you don't have an opportunity while the light is green, you're supposed to clear the intersection (ie: make your turn) when the light is yellow. Obviously people are assholes and try to beat the yellow, so if you go when the light turns red because that's the only safe opportunity, a cop likely would never give you a ticket for that (would be more likely to give a ticket to a person running a yellow).

In this instance, though, the light was obviously green, meaning the truck driver made an unsafe turn. If the conditions were better, maybe the guy would have made the turn. Any time you're going against traffic, though, liability is basically automatically yours, regardless of situation.
